In case you didn't watch the episode, here's how things went down. After a heated battle at the Alexandria Safe-Zone, Carl and the rest of the Grimes Gang made it to safety in sewer tunnels underneath the community... except, as Carl's dad Rick (Andrew Lincoln) and his de facto mom Michonne (Danai Gurira) found out, he had been bitten by a walker days earlier, while trying to save the life of a man named Siddiq (Avi Nash).

Riggs will return for one more episode when the show returns next year, in order to take care of some of Carl's unfinished business -- mainly making sure Rick learns the concept of mercy -- but that doesn't mean fans aren't FREAKING OUT.
